1

控制台中的错误

shubhabrata@shubhabrata-VirtualBox:~/Meteor/myapp$ mupx deploy

Meteor Up:生产质量 Meteor 部署

配置文件:mup.json 设置文件:settings.json

“结帐卡迪拉!这是监控应用性能的最佳方式。访问:https ://kadira.io/mup ”</p>

Meteor 应用路径:/home/shubhabrata/Meteor/myapp 使用 buildOptions:{} buffer.js:80 throw new Error(^

错误:如果指定了编码,则第一个参数必须是可读的新缓冲区 (buffer.js:80:13) 处的字符串。(/usr/lib/node_modules/mupx/node_modules/archiver/lib/util/index.js:32:15) 在emitNone (events.js:91:20) 在Readable.emit (events.js:188:7)在 endReadableNT (_stream_readable.js:975:12) 在 _combinedTickCallback (internal/process/next_tick.js:80:11) 在 process._tickCallback (internal/process/next_tick.js:104:9)

4

1 回答 1

0

从节点 7 切换到节点 5.12 对我有用。我使用 nvm 安装,以便将来可以使用更高版本的节点。

这发生在我(故意)使用旧版本的 mup 时。很可能只是升级 mup 就可以解决问题。

于 2017-04-18T11:30:17.453 回答